Coarse Bubble Membrane Diffuser Market - Global Forecast 2026-2032

The Coarse Bubble Membrane Diffuser Market size was estimated at USD 213.19 million in 2025 and expected to reach USD 229.70 million in 2026, at a CAGR of 7.27% to reach USD 348.49 million by 2032.

Pioneering Material Innovations Digital Integration and Regulatory Pressures Are Redefining Aeration Efficiency and Sustainability

Over the last few years, the landscape of coarse bubble membrane diffusers has been reshaped by several converging trends that are driving innovation, sustainability, and performance gains. First, the evolution of advanced membrane materials such as EPDM, polyurethane, and silicone has delivered enhanced durability and oxygen transfer rates, enabling operators to achieve lower energy consumption and longer service intervals. Concurrently, digital monitoring technologies have been integrated into diffuser systems, providing real-time performance data, predictive maintenance alerts, and remote management capabilities that reduce downtime and further improve cost-effectiveness.

Regulatory pressures aimed at reducing greenhouse gas emissions and limiting nutrient discharge have also catalyzed a shift toward higher efficiency aeration solutions. As water tariffs and energy costs climb, municipal and industrial end users are adopting coarse bubble membrane diffusers to secure compliance while curbing operational expenses. Meanwhile, the rising focus on aquaculture productivity is driving specialty applications in pond aeration and recirculating systems, where reliable oxygen delivery is critical to maintaining fish health and maximizing yield. Collectively, these transformative shifts underscore a broader move toward integrated, data-driven, and materials-optimized approaches that redefine what modern aeration systems can achieve.

Trade Policy Shifts and Localized Production Investments Are Fortifying Supply Chains Against Tariff-Induced Cost Pressures

The imposition of United States tariffs in 2025 on imported membrane materials and finished diffuser assemblies has had a pronounced effect on supply chains, vendor strategies, and cost structures across the coarse bubble membrane diffuser market. These levies, which targeted key inputs such as EPDM and polyurethane compounds, elevated raw material costs for domestic manufacturers and spurred a recalibration of sourcing strategies. As a direct consequence, several leading producers accelerated investments in local production capabilities to mitigate exposure to tariff volatility and secure more stable supply lines.

Furthermore, the cascading impact of higher input costs prompted distributors and aftermarket service providers to revisit pricing models, forging closer collaborations with OEMs to bundle maintenance services and replacement components. This collaborative approach proved essential in preserving margin structures while maintaining the delivery of high-performance diffusers. In parallel, energy-intensive industrial sectors such as chemicals, food & beverage, and oil & gas, which rely heavily on efficient aeration, adjusted procurement cycles to hedge against further tariff adjustments. The cumulative result has been a market-wide emphasis on supply chain resilience, cost containment, and strategic stockpiling of critical materials to ensure continuity of operations under shifting trade policies.

Decoding Application-Specific Demand Patterns Across Industries Materials and Service Models to Guide Strategic Offerings

A granular examination of market segmentation reveals distinct dynamics shaping demand across end use industries, device types, materials, distribution channels, end users, and pressure categories. In municipal applications, the priority on meeting stringent effluent quality standards has driven rapid adoption of disc, panel, and tubular diffusers crafted from resilient EPDM and polyurethane blends. Industrial sectors such as mining, pharmaceuticals, and pulp & paper show a growing preference for silicone-based membranes that withstand harsh chemical conditions, while aquaculture operators increasingly specify systems optimized for pond aeration and recirculating systems to boost oxygen transfer and reduce water turnover.

On the distribution front, direct sales channels remain dominant for large-scale OEM projects, whereas distributors and e-commerce platforms have emerged as vital conduits for aftermarket demand-particularly for maintenance services and replacement components. Pressure category selections also vary by application: high pressure diffusers are favored in deep tank industrial setups, medium pressure systems strike a balance for municipal installations, and low pressure devices are preferred in shallow aquaculture environments. Through this lens, it becomes clear that suppliers capable of tailoring device types, membrane compositions, and service models to these diverse requirements will capture the fullest spectrum of market opportunity.

Navigating Divergent Regional Adoption Drivers From Regulatory Mandates to Infrastructure Investments and Aquaculture Growth

Regional variations underscore the importance of aligning product portfolios and go-to-market strategies with local drivers and challenges. In the Americas, legacy municipal infrastructure upgrades and stringent environmental regulations continue to fuel stable demand for high-efficiency coarse bubble membrane diffusers, with manufacturers emphasizing high pressure and medium pressure devices to meet diverse treatment plant configurations. Evolving industrial standards in the Americas have spurred adoption in chemicals and food & beverage, where energy savings translate directly into operational cost reductions.

Across Europe, the Middle East, and Africa, robust regulatory frameworks around nutrient discharge and carbon emissions are accelerating investments in retrofit projects and new installations. Here, silicone diffusers leverage their chemical resilience in oil & gas and mining applications, while panel and tubular designs gain traction for municipal wastewater remediation. In Asia-Pacific, rapid urbanization, water scarcity concerns, and burgeoning aquaculture sectors are driving growth in pond aeration and recirculating systems. Low pressure diffusers predominate in emerging markets, supported by a mix of direct sales and distributor networks to navigate complex regional logistics and service requirements.

Strategic Alliances and Advanced Product Portfolios Redefine Competitive Benchmarks While Expanding Global Footprints

Leading companies in the coarse bubble membrane diffuser market are leveraging product innovation, strategic partnerships, and geographic expansion to reinforce their competitive positions. Established OEMs have differentiated through advanced membrane formulations and modular diffuser designs that simplify installation and optimize oxygen transfer. Several players have formed alliances with technology providers to embed sensors and analytics platforms, enabling centralized performance monitoring and predictive maintenance.

Meanwhile, aftermarket service specialists have expanded maintenance programs and replacement component offerings, driving recurring revenue streams and deepening customer relationships. These companies are also exploring e-commerce platforms to reach smaller end users and niche markets rapidly. Strategic acquisitions have further consolidated capabilities, with key players integrating local manufacturing operations to buffer against tariff disruptions and reduce lead times. Collectively, these corporate maneuvers highlight a dual emphasis on innovation and supply chain agility, setting the competitive benchmark for the broader market.
